Despite the enthusiasm, some concerns were raised. Issues related to location and
                accessibility, particularly for families with young children, were noted. Financial sustainability was
                also questioned, with some suggesting that resources be used to improve existing amenities
                instead of building new ones.

                    The survey results highlight several major themes: strong support for youth and fitness-
                oriented programs, high demand for multipurpose and recreational spaces, and a clear
                expectation of frequent usage. Ensuring the center’s inclusivity and accessibility will be critical to
                its success. In conclusion, by addressing the community’s needs and suggestions, the Town of
                Berlin has the opportunity to create a dynamic, well-utilized community center that enhances the
                quality of life for its residents.
